Joe's Cellar
1332 NW 21st Ave., Portland, OR 97209
Corner of NW 21st & Pettygrove
Northwest
(503) 223-2851
Joe's Cellar Cafe
: Hours
Breakfast Daily - 7:00 a.m.
American Diner


From Barfly:

"On the edge of northwest's still-extant industrial zones, the damnably-loyal blue-collar and blue-haired (some choosing retirement locale upon Joe's proximity) regulars drink chockablock 'round the horseshoe bar with gentler new locals and journalist manques wandering down from the new WW HQ."[1]

First Thursdays

1.jpg

Authors in Pubs is a 'First Thursday' event that brings local writers into a bar, restaurant or where-ever, and allows them to share their work with the patrons. This helps to boost the confidence of the writer by gettingfirst hand feedback on his/her work. Stop by for a beverage, bite to eat or better yet, join our little group and read a story of your own.
